About this role

Serves as an expert/lead team member coordinating communication among patients, families, clinicians, and payors to obtain demographic and insurance information and ensure accurate registration and payment of hospital accounts. Provides registration, clerical, and billing support including insurance verification, chart creation, scheduling, and charge entry. Collaborates with Appeals and Patient Accounting to prevent and overturn claim denials and supports hiring and orientation of new registration staff.

Children's Healthcare of Atlanta is a nonprofit pediatric healthcare system dedicated to providing specialized medical care for infants, children, and adolescents. It delivers comprehensive services—acute inpatient care, emergency services, outpatient clinics, and specialty programs—through multidisciplinary teams focused on family-centered care. The organization emphasizes research, education, and community outreach to improve child health outcomes. Their stated commitment is to make sure children are better today for a healthier tomorrow.
